Abstract
The authors describe an AC motor drive simulation software package for the AC regulator-controlled induction motor in which the motor is modeled on d-q axes in the state space and the AC regulator is modeled using the principles of pulse-width-modulation. The software package is menu-driven and can be employed to either demonstrate open-loop control of the motor drive or investigate the design of closed-loop control algorithms. Example results of some typical open and closed-loop control simulations are presented.
